A LURISTAN BRONZE HORNED FIGURE
EARLY 1ST MILLENNIUM B.C.
The stylized elongated figure wearing horned headdress, with large heavy rimmed eyes under long incised eyebrows, large nose and fleshy lips, hands clasped in front holding a sword(?), faint traces of an incised belt, prominent buttocks behind, mounted
5 in. (12.7 cm.) high
